Output 75f11382d6de4877b43e3faa047b09cf2a96eede61cf54d66480a6d61096affc:14

value
138276574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 292b396f2a6ee788ca5e4013dbdbfa9d14f96b08 OP_EQUAL
address
35ShQgwcNmRKCt2UYe9BZz3YwwTYs4MfEk
transaction
75f11382d6de4877b43e3faa047b09cf2a96eede61cf54d66480a6d61096affc
confirmations
331004
spent
true